three.js从入门到精通系列教程015 - three.js使用TextGeometry绘制变形三维文字
·
<!DOCTYPE html>
<html>
<head>
<meta charset="UTF-8">
<title>three.js从入门到精通系列教程015 - three.js使用TextGeometry绘制变形三维文字</title>
<script src="ThreeJS/three.js"></script>
<script src="ThreeJS/jquery.js"></script>
</head>
<body>
<center id="myContainer"></center>
<script type="text/javascript">
//创建渲染器
var myRenderer = new THREE.WebGLRenderer({ antialias: true });
myRenderer.setSize(window.innerWidth, window.innerHeight);
$("#myContainer").append(myRenderer.domElement);
var myScene = new THREE.Scene();
myScene.background = new THREE.Color('white');
var myCamera = new THREE.PerspectiveCamera(45,
window.innerWidth / window.innerHeight, 0.1, 1000);
myCamera.position.set(0, 40, 700);
myScene.add(myCamera);
//加载字库并绘制字母
var myFontLoader = new THREE.FontLoader();
/*
THREE.TextGeometry(text, parameters)
text是文字字符串;
parameters是以下参数组成的对象:
· size:字号大小,一般为大写字母的高度
· height:文字的厚度
· curveSegments:弧线分段数,使得文字的曲线更加光滑
· font:字体,默认是'helvetiker',需对应引用的字体文件
· weight:值为'normal'或'bold',表示是否加粗
· style:值为'normal'或'italics',表示是否斜体
· bevelEnabled:布尔值,是否使用倒角,意为在边缘处斜切
· bevelThickness:倒角厚度
· bevelSize:倒角宽度
*/
myFontLoader.load('Data/optimer_bold.typeface.json', function (font) {
var myGeometry = new THREE.TextGeometry('hello', { font: font, size: 80 });
//计算当前几何体的范围
myGeometry.computeBoundingBox();
//计算字母(几何体)当前中心的偏移量
var myOffsetX = (myGeometry.boundingBox.max.x
- myGeometry.boundingBox.min.x) / 2;
var myOffsetY = (myGeometry.boundingBox.max.y
- myGeometry.boundingBox.min.y) / 2;
var myMaterial = new THREE.MeshBasicMaterial({ color: 0x0000ff });
var myTextMesh = new THREE.Mesh(myGeometry, myMaterial);
myTextMesh.position.x = myGeometry.boundingBox.min.x - myOffsetX;
myTextMesh.position.y = myGeometry.boundingBox.min.y + myOffsetY;
myScene.add(myTextMesh);
});
//渲染绘制的字母
animate();
function animate() {
requestAnimationFrame(animate);
myCamera.lookAt(new THREE.Vector3(0, 100, 0));
myRenderer.render(myScene, myCamera);
}
</script>
</body>
</html>
